Wahkiakum County approves $16,655 IT VLAN project from communications reserve

The Wahkiakum County Board of Commissioners voted unanimously Feb. 10 to approve four VLAN project segments costing a combined $16,655.10. Commissioners Lee Tischer and Mark Letham moved and seconded the approval; the motion passed with votes recorded as Aye from Tischer, Letham and Chair Dan Cothren.
The board authorized the expense to be paid from the Electronic Communications Cumulative Reserve Fund. No amendments or conditions were recorded in the minutes. The approval follows an IT Committee recommendation and is intended to advance network segmentation work identified in county technology planning.
Why it matters: The expenditure represents an investment in county network infrastructure intended to support secure communications for county operations.
